Acutally I can see what the problem is. The cSeq number of the BYE is wrong. In the trace you posted it is 658568416 The INVITE is 1 The BYE must have a CSeq number of 2. Hence it is invalid and has been rejected. I opened an issue but I will close it as "External system error" because I believe the iTSP is in error. Regards Ranga. > On Feb 14, 2010, at 3:10 PM, M.
